What We Need :

At iHeartMedia, our media savvy team is charged with ensuring a strategic and successful execution across our full audio and digital product suite including the latest broadcast, podcast, streaming audio, social, video, display media, and custom tactics. We are seeking an outstanding Campaign Manager to join our team to lead and maintain a roster of clients represented by independent agency partners. This Campaign Manager will have the opportunity to think strategically and help support the development of key growth areas for iHeartMedia, and team with sales, client partnerships, pre-sale campaign development, social, programming, creative production, research, ad / pod operations and inventory management to ensure smooth campaign management. The position requires extensive cross-group coordination at all levels, excellent communication and analytic skills, and strong organizational skills.

The right candidate should have knowledge and experience of the broadcast and digital media space. This person is a self-starter and entrepreneurial project manager, capable of motivating internal and external teams, as well as communicating effectively with both junior and executive level clients. Responsible for maintaining excellent relationships with internal departments as well as with independent media agencies by providing outstanding campaign management, client service, and campaign wrap up reports ultimately driving incremental revenue and client renewals.

What You'll Do :

Media Buying / Planning

  • Monitor buying strategies; liaising and building relationships with clients and internal / external divisions / vendors
  • Undertakes research using a wide range of internal and external media resources
  • Identifies the target audience for a particular campaign and decides how best to communicate to that audience
  • Builds effective broadcast media and digital campaign plans using detailed media planning guidelines and flowcharts
  • Collaborate with team members to understand the clients’ business objectives and develop comprehensive media strategy
  • Secures and negotiates the best rates and terms for all types of media to support the overall media plan
  • Keep abreast of industry news and develop POVs to communicate relevant updates to client / internal teams

Media Execution

  • Collaborating with internal departments to ensure that sold programs are booked and executed in alignment with operational and sales initiatives
  • Primary Client Contact for all post-campaign programs. Schedule and lead all internal / external calls, communicate production timelines and deliverables, and overall ensure the iHeartMedia experience exceeds client expectations
  • Maintain and optimize client campaigns to improve overall performance against pre-determined benchmarks on an ongoing basis
  • Responsible for full delivery against dollars booked across all broadcast, digital, social, and podcast deliverables
  • Work with ad / pod ops to provide critical thinking and troubleshoot any creative / tracking issues
  • Provide industry-leading post-campaign analysis by partnering with internal subject matter experts, and creating comprehensive recaps, learnings, & recommendations
  • Create promotional recaps for each project
  • Create sales orders, process traffic instructions, and promotional paperwork
  • Project Management

  • Day to day duties include digital asset creation and delivery tracking, research, ideation on projects, strategic proposal writing, statistical analysis, schedule building, trafficking creative to media partners, and recap preparation
  • Works on a wide range of client accounts at the same time, often juggling various projects and deadlines
  • Collaborate with our internal billing & finance team monthly to ensure reconciling billing promptly
  • Work on Special projects as assigned
